JOB SUMMARY

 

A specialist engineering and technical services provider supporting the energy sector, with a strong focus on upstream oil and gas operations. The organisation delivers high-quality subsurface and production solutions, partnering with operators to optimise reservoir performance and enhance hydrocarbon recovery. It is recognised for its technical expertise, collaborative approach, and commitment to delivering data-driven insights across complex assets. The PVT Engineer will play a critical role in supporting reservoir and production engineering activities through detailed fluid characterization and analysis. This position is responsible for interpreting PVT data, developing and tuning EOS models, and ensuring accurate fluid representation for reservoir simulation studies. Working closely with subsurface and laboratory teams, the role contributes directly to reservoir understanding and field development planning. The successful candidate will bring strong technical expertise and the ability to translate laboratory data into actionable engineering insights.

 

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

• Conduct detailed PVT analysis and fluid characterization using laboratory and field data

• Develop, calibrate, and tune Equation of State (EOS) models for reservoir simulation

• Interpret and validate PVT laboratory results to ensure data quality and consistency

• Provide fluid property inputs and support for reservoir simulation and production engineering studies Collaborate with reservoir engineers to integrate fluid models into dynamic simulation workflows

• Support fluid sampling programs, including design, execution, and data interpretation

• Prepare technical reports and present findings to internal stakeholders and clients

• Ensure alignment with industry standards and best practices in PVT analysis
